Lafayette offers a classic French bakery and bistro experience. They are particularly known for their pastries, with specific mentions of their unique spiral croissants (Suprêmes) and canelés. The French onion soup is also a standout, noted for its generous portion of beef and inclusion of short rib. While many dishes receive praise, one negative review mentioned a sour pistachio croissant.
